About this item:

  • Waterproof: Fully waterproof and windproof material with sealed seams.
  • Lightweight: Ultra-lightweight material: 4.9 oz (139 g) in size M
  • Compact design: Folds into its own inside pocket and slips into a jersey back pocket.
  • Breathability: Ventilation openings at the back and on underarms.

Product waterproofing

Waterproofing is a fabric's ability to prevent rain water from passing through. A fabric's waterproofing is determined by measuring its resistance to the pressure exerted by a water column, measured in mm (test based on ISO 811 standard). The higher the pressure, the more waterproof the fabric. Material with a waterproof rating of 2000 mm resists the pressure exerted by 2000 mm of water (which roughly corresponds to a 2-hour rain shower).Our Ultralight jacket is waterproof up to 2000 mm.

Breathability

To determine whether a fabric is breathable, we measure its evaporative resistance (test based on standard ISO 11092). The lower its resistance, the more the fabric will let water vapor produced by the body escape, and therefore the more breathable it is. For example: RET < 9 = extremely breathable materialThe RET of our Ultralight showerproof jacket is 6.

Care tips

Hand wash only. Turn the article inside out. Use a minimal amount of laundry detergent. Do not use fabric softener. Line dry in a warm, ventilated area. Do not tumble dry. Do not tumble dry. Do not bleach. Do not place on a heater to dry.
